What Types of Work and Facilities Can Diagnostic Sonographers Expect in Sanford, NC?

As a Sonographer working with AMN Healthcare in Sanford, North Carolina, you’ll have the opportunity to engage in a variety of diagnostic imaging roles across diverse healthcare facilities, including hospitals, outpatient clinics, and specialty medical centers. In these settings, you can expect to perform a range of ultrasound examinations to assist in diagnosing medical conditions, utilizing advanced imaging technology to provide high-quality images and data for physicians. The scope of your work may include abdominal ultrasounds, obstetric and gynecological imaging, and vascular studies, depending on the facility’s focus and patient needs. Additionally, you may find opportunities for collaboration with multidisciplinary teams, contributing to comprehensive patient care while enhancing your professional skills in a supportive community environment.

Travel Sonographer jobs in New York let you perform ultrasound imaging procedures to help physicians diagnose and monitor medical conditions. You will operate ultrasound equipment, prepare patients, analyze image quality, and collaborate with healthcare teams. Recommended qualifications include ARDMS certification, graduation from a CAAHEP-accredited sonography program, and passing the Sonography Principles and Instrumentation exam. Additional certifications from ARRT or CCI may be accepted depending on the assignment. Specialties such as OB/GYN, Abdomen, or Vascular can increase your versatility1.
